Add a system that allows game creators to give away robux in custom events within their games (Fairly obviously roblox will take a cut). (Don't forget to add a customizable cap on this! Don't want all of someones robux just disappearing) This would lure NBC's to more unpopular games and experience a wider game market than sticking to a couple games they've always played. This would allow NBC's another possible way to get robux away from groups. This would allow game creators to add more powerful advertisement to their games. Obviously this isn't a well thought out idea, however from what I actually think on the basis of this.. it has potential. Creators can simply add custom events within their games through script that allow users to earn robux after completing achievements.. Additions needed: (Add an option to maximize how much one person can get)[Would stop hackers but generally not multiple accounts, not that NBC's can really trade robux.] (Customizable cap on the amount that you give within a day... week?) Flaws(s)? : Creators would then be able to simply give away robux. Hackers? The system would need to be iron tight. (Possibly an approval process?) I think it should be a ROBLOX feature for developers to host custom events and giveaways, without having to do too much scripting (Like an actualy intergrated event system) but this thread needs some fine-tuning. And just some if my ideas: The events will have to go through a moderation system perhaps to make sure its not just a free player attention grab, and to keep the number of events at once low. A developer aldo must "buy in" the event (aka invest money into it) so they can't just take free advertisements from saying "Event here for R$! Lololol" and then cancel the event just do they don't have to give away the cash they promise in their event. And while doing an event the game could be under a 'spotlight' type page on the games page (also have to buy in because this is bassically advertising). Also hackers will most deffinately be a thing but if Devs notice a user with an obvious large amount of the game's goal objective, lets say gold for example, I believe the creator has the right to exempt that user from the event (maybe roblox mods could monitor events).
